Pauline MacMillan Keinath (born July 31, 1934) is an American billionaire heiress. She is a great-granddaughter of William W. Cargill, the founder of Cargill, the largest private company in the US. [10], While the "low-profile family" owns Cargill, and there are six family members on the 17-member board, family members have not been part of running the company since 1995, when Whitney MacMillan, who had served as Cargill's chairman and chief executive officer (CEO) since 1976, stepped down as chief executive in 1995. [1] Descendants of Cargill and MacMillan have owned common equity in the "agribusiness giant" Cargill Inc, one of the largest privately owned corporations in the United States,[2][3] for over 140 years. With fourteen billionaires in the family in 2019,[1][8] the Cargill family has more individual billionaires among its members than any other family anywhere in the world,[9] making them the family with the most wealthy members in history. [33][39] Three of Cargill MacMillan Sr's four children Whitney MacMillan, Alice Whitney MacMillan, and Pauline MacMillan Keinath (born 1934 in Hennepin County, Minnesota),[33] were on "The 400 Richest Americans 2009" with a listed revenue of $4.3 billion each.
